Akania bidwillii     (Hogg) Mabb.

This native tree is commonly known as turnip wood.

Akania bidwillii is described as a "dicot" in the Akaniaceae family.

In the Queensland Nature Conservation Act it is classified as Least Concern. Under the Federal Environment Protection Biodiversity Conservation Act it is not classified.

Main distribution from Sunshine Coast southward. No records in Fraser Coast region.  

It has been recorded in the Wide Bay district in the Queensland Herbarium Census but is not listed as occurring in the Fraser Coast region in Queensland Herbarium Wildlife Online.
